Deer in Morningside?? No Kidding.

Gaston and Charon Nogues moved from Los Angeles into a Land Bank house on the corner of Nottingham and Cornwall a few years ago and brought with them a vision of the surrounding vacant lots as cultivated gardens and a community gathering space.

They’ve been slowly realizing that vision over the past five years. It has proven to be popular, not just with their neighbors, but with forest creatures as well. Who’d have guessed it?

“I have to get a deer crossing sign now,” says Gaston. “We have four showing up for the corn now, the word must be getting out.”
